➢ Dry Granulation Strategy: In this technique, the API and excipients are compacted to sort slugs or ribbons, which happen to be then milled into granules. These granules are compressed into tablets. ➢ Damp Granulation Strategy: In this method, the API and excipients are blended, and also a liquid binder is added to sort a damp mass. The moist mass is then granulated, dried, and compressed into tablets.

Floating systems include things like non-effervescent and effervescent forms that float due to very low density or gas technology. Substantial-density systems don't float but stay during the tummy as a result of bioadhesion, magnetic forces, swelling to a significant dimensions, or raft formation prolonged release vs sustained release on gastric fluids.
Effervescent tablets are intended to evolve carbon dioxide when in contact with drinking water and disintegrate in just a couple of minutes. These are uncoated tablets consisting of acids (citric or tartaric acid) and carbonates or bicarbonates which respond promptly in drinking water and release carbon dioxide. They may be meant to be both dispersed or dissolved in h2o just before ingestion to provide incredibly speedy pill dispersion and dissolution and release of your drug.
